![]() |
|
||||||||||
|
|||||||
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| Опции просмотра |
|
![]() |
![]() |
|
|||||
|
Добрый вечер.
Такой вот вопрос: БД: Oracle или MS SQL 2005? ПП: C++, C# или Java? (1С не предлагать =)))
__________________
__________________ |
|
|||||
|
Сам юзал C# + MSSQL.
А чиво надо-то ? |
|
|||||
|
Сществует некое издательство, которое занимается производством печатной продукции периодического информационно-справочного характера (от детских садиков до ВУЗов, санаториев, домов отдыха, магазинов, и т. д. и т. п., вообщем всего, что можно найти), как раз о нем я вскользь упомянул в прошлой теме.
Также, вся эта продукция, естесственно доступна в эл. виде на некотором сайте, ссылку на который давать просто стыдно, потому как это один из наиболее ярких примеров классического отстоя середины девяностых годов прошлого века (как дизайн, так и функциональность, точнее отсутствие таковых =) ). Когда я года два назад (как и положено — по знакомству =) ) пришел в эту «конторку», из кучи необходимых программ немного знал только Фотошоп, а из области интернета — рисование слоев в Дриме, поэтому тупо, молча следовал производственной инструкции. Но со временем, параллельно с работой, исследуя интернет пространство, выяснилось, что хтмл гораздо удобнее писать руками (UltraEdit foreva =)), что есть такая штука как CSS, JavaScript, потом, когда понадобилось сделать небольшую фотогалерею для сайта, стало ясно, что создавать руками 133 хтмл файла с картинками — как-то не правильно, должна быть какая-то технология, и действительно, постепенно обнаружилось, что есть ПХП, XML, XSL, базы данных, mod_rewrite и все такое... И вот в один прекрасный день, когда до меня, как до жирафа, наконец-то доперло, что при производстве очередного выпкуска справочника, %45 рабочего времени тратится на тупую, ручную работу, да еще если учесть, что издание-то периодическое, и больше половины информации может просто идти без изменений, стало ясно, что так более продолжаться не может. Поэтому немедленно «было принято политическое решение поставить вопрос о проведении всех необходимых мероприятий по автоматизации, оптимизации, универсализации, стандартизации и глобализации всех производственных процессов с целью максимального сокращения нерационального использования ручного труда, задействуя все доступные средства, в настоящий момент имеющиеся в наличии…» (не удержался от протокольной фразы =)). После предварительного анализа, было установлено, что для начала достижения поставленной цели потребуется гигабайт на 750 raid-массив 0+1, база данных и документированное клиентское приложение, реализованное на одном из наиболее подходящих языков программирования, со всем необходимым функционалом, отвечающим специфике данного производства. Естесственно, так как это обычное явление на нормальном предприятии, то все «велосипеды» и «колеса» уже давно придуманы, отлажены, и работают, но, к сож. лично сталкиваться с этим не приходилось и знакомых в этой области (пока) не имеется, поэтому, если кто-что — как обычно — буду весьма =).
__________________
__________________ |
|
|||||
|
Ого...
Ну C++ явно перебор. Найдёшь дотнетчика - он убедит что делать надо на дотнете, найдёшь явера - тот убедит что только жава самый лучший вариант... А какую БД юзать вообще-то вопрос десятый. |
|
|||||
|
=), ну это — да, каждый кулик свое болото, но вообще обычно убеждают конкретные факты, а почему ++ перебор, шарп вроде еще покруче будет?
Вообще стратегия такая, что надо исходя из максимального удобства, была бы возможность, я б вообще все на пхп сделал =)), сейчас кстати пришлось утилиту пакетного переименования файлов на пхп сделать, потомучто там есть PCRE и понятно все =)) да и с текстом тоже удобно работать..
__________________
__________________ Последний раз редактировалось drwhite; 10.06.2007 в 07:24. |
|
|||||
|
Просто написать на С++ программу намного сложнее и дороже. С++ здесь точно не нужен.
Значит ты хочешь написать эта мега бизнес приложение заодно и изучив какой-нибудь язык C#/JAVA ? =))) |
|
|||||
|
ага, именно «супертурбомегабизнес» приложение, а заодно изучив не только какой-нибудь язык (по возможности больше), но и все то, о чем говорилось в предыдущей теме. =))
А почему дороже, писать-то ведь я буду, а себе не дороже, себе «лучше день потерять, зато потом за пять минут долететь» =)) И вообще, благо, я в свое время понял, как все-таки работает это «четрово» изобретение (эвм), и оказалось, что как всегда — все гениальное — просто, причем на столько просто, что иногда не верится, проблема понимания современных эвм только в количестве (лог. вентилей), переходящем в качество, и в принципе… в принципе, самое тонкое место в программировании, да и влюбой в области науки, это перевод задачи с обычного языка на язык этой области, в которой решается текущая задача — в данном случае нужно дружить с математикой, логикой (булева алгебра), ну и с головой немножко, да и поможет нам трехтомник Дональда Кнута, Интернет и МИРЭА, аминь =))) …и вообще, самые крутые чуваки не те, которые пишут декомпиляторы, а те, которые могут правильно исполнить на скрипке двадцать четвертый каприз Паганини (хрен сыграешь =)) )
__________________
__________________ Последний раз редактировалось drwhite; 10.06.2007 в 08:48. |
![]() |
![]() |
Часовой пояс GMT +4, время: 22:53. |
|
|
« Предыдущая тема | Следующая тема » |
|
|